Analysis

South Africa recorded 424,344 1000 USD for non food — gross production value in 2024.

That represents a change of down 39.5% on the previous year and down 11.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, non food — gross production value in South Africa peaked at 758,982 1000 USD in 2019 and was at its lowest, 109,428 1000 USD, in 1994.

That places South Africa 12th out of 119 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
